Trying to reverse a family curse, brothers Jimmy (Channing Tatum) and Clyde Logan (Adam Driver) set out to execute an elaborate robbery during the legendary Coca-Cola 600 race at the Charlotte Motor Speedway.

I went into Logan Lucky with trepidation. The cast was immense, but director Soderbergh has been a nit hit and miss in the last 10 years. However, my fears were put to rest, as Logan Lucky turned into a hilarious heist movie I hope it would be.

Helped along by some brilliant acting by an all star cast, the story looks at a group trying to steal from a NASCAR race. As with any heist movie things don't always go to plan, and there are multiple problems along the way for our cast to get around. There are some seriously funny moments in this film too, proper belly chuckling stuff.
